**FAQ: First-aid room access**

First-aid room is on the ground floor, beside the Wrenhall Suite. Unlocked during core hours (08:00–18:00). Trained first-aiders listed on the noticeboard outside. Restock requests go to facilities, not reception. Out of hours, the room stays locked; duty reception can open it with the standing access code.

turnstile pass: bdg-NG-3

## Configuration

Castcheck, our podcast feed validator, needs exactly two env settings to run. First, FEED_TIMEOUT_MS controls how long we'll wait on a slow feed. Second is the credential for the Audiolith fetch proxy — reviewers, note this never appears in logs. Add it to your .env on the next line.

vault entry, kawep-yahof: LEDGER_TOKEN29=aed31a7c3a275025cbea1ab2c10a7

### CSV import wizard: stuck jobs

If a customer's CSV import sits in "validating" for more than ten minutes, the Gristmill parser service has probably dropped the job. Just requeue it from the admin panel — no need to escalate. The requeue call hits our internal Gristmill API, and it needs the key below to authenticate.

gateway credential: kto3_qfe

Capacity note for the Tarrowfield inventory reconciliation job. Current run chews through roughly 40M SKU rows nightly and finishes with little headroom; warehouse onboarding in Q3 will double that. Plan is to widen the worker pool and raise the chunk size rather than add hosts. Don't change anything without checking the Dunridge staging replay first — the job is sensitive to lock contention on the ledger table. Constants as currently deployed are listed here.

constants for fajop-tahaf:
RATE_LIMITS = {
    "holael": 2,
    "oliael": 10,
    "druael": 10,
    "wenwyn": 10,
}

### Step 6: Configure the connection pool

Before deploying Millhaven's API tier, set the pool size in pool.conf. Start with 20 connections per instance; the database caps at 400 total, so count your instances before scaling. Idle connections recycle after 300 seconds — don't disable this, or failovers leave stale sockets. Watch the pool-wait metric after rollout; sustained waits above 50 ms mean the pool is undersized. Deploy manifests must be signed with the key below.

rollout seal: bky4_x7Gc